>The following code demostrate a bug that i discover sometime ago in VFp7 & 6 ...
>
>The bug involve two classes that have the same name but are in two different class-container, when this classes are used for subclassing in the same work-session without issuing a CLEAR ALL between the operation, VFP act a "classMerging".
>
>I supposed that VFP in his cache, when try to reuse the cached classes, performs erroneous searches.
>
>Can, Anyone that have VFP8.0 Beta, try this code for me, and say me if the problem persist ?
>
>Thanx in Advance
>
>** Cut Here
>IF !FILE('sub\b2.vcx')
> cProg = SYS(16)
> DO makeclasses IN &cProg
>ENDIF
>cProg = SYS(16)
>DO checkclasses IN &cProg
>RETURN
>
>PROCEDURE makeclasses
> MESSAGEBOX("To the class which appears, add a label with caption 'class 1', fontsize 24 and AutoSize = .T. then save the class", 0, "Class Problem")
> CREATE CLASS baseform OF classes AS FORM
> CLEAR ALL
> MESSAGEBOX("Save the following class as is", 0, "Class Problem")
> CREATE CLASS BASE OF base1 AS baseform FROM classes
> CLEAR ALL
> MESSAGEBOX("Change the caption of the next classes label to 'class 2'", 0, "Class Problem")
> CREATE CLASS BASE OF base2 AS baseform FROM classes
> CLEAR ALL
> MESSAGEBOX("Save the following class as is", 0, "Class Problem")
> CREATE CLASS SubBASE1 OF b1 AS BASE FROM base1
> CLEAR ALL
> MESSAGEBOX("Save the following class as is", 0, "Class Problem")
> CREATE CLASS SubBASE2 OF b2 AS BASE FROM base2
> CLEAR ALL
>ENDPROC
>
>PROCEDURE checkclasses
> MODIFY CLASS SubBASE1 OF b1 NOWAIT
> MESSAGEBOX("sub class b1: you should see 'class 1'", 0, "Class Problem")
> CLOSE ALL
> MODIFY CLASS SubBASE2 OF b2 NOWAIT
> MESSAGEBOX("sub class b2: you should see 'class 2'", 0, "Class Problem")
> CLOSE ALL
> MODIFY CLASS SubBASE1 OF b1 NOWAIT
> MESSAGEBOX("back to sub class b1: you should see 'class 1' but you see 'class 2'", 0, "Class Problem")
> CLOSE ALL
> CLEAR ALL
> MODIFY CLASS SubBASE1 OF b1 NOWAIT
> MESSAGEBOX("back to sub class b1: you should see 'class 1' and you see 'class 1' because CLEAR ALL was issued", 0, "Class Problem")
> CLOSE ALL
>ENDPROC
>
>** Cut Here

Fixed :)
